Output d86e35cbc7157f9a5b72fbccfcaf091d40d98b2e0ea48652cb4eba7c9dbdcef7: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df18437902d2869006ad0d46d018ca27d4cf7a21 OP_EQUAL
address
3N2dgBdFD4h6AACBSh3uipPQvoLnuKhNGW
transaction
d86e35cbc7157f9a5b72fbccfcaf091d40d98b2e0ea48652cb4eba7c9dbdcef7
confirmations
481028
spent
true